Pandharkawda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Pandharkawda Village has a population of 477 (477) with 246 (246) males and 231 (231) females.The sex ratio in Pandharkawda is 940, indicating a below-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Pandharkawda Village is 68 (68) which is 14.26% of Pandharkawda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Pandharkawda Village is 1267 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Pandharkawda village is listed as part of the Wardha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Wardha District in the state of MAHARASHTRA in INDIA.

Pandharkawda Literacy Rate
Pandharkawda Village has a literacy rate of 76.04% which is higher than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Pandharkawda Village is 83.8 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Pandharkawda Village is 67.36 higher than national average of 64.63%.

Pandharkawda Scheduled Castes (SC) Population
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Pandharkawda Village is 19 (19) with 12 (12) males and 7 (7) females, which is 3.98% of Pandharkawda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 584 females for every 1000 males.
Pandharkawda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population
Scheduled Tribes(ST) Population in Pandharkawda Village is 267 (267) with 134 (134) males and 133 (133) females, which is 55.97% of Pandharkawda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Tribes is 993 females for every 1000 males.

Pandharkawda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view
In Pandharkawda Village, there are about 252 (252) workers, making up nearly 52.83% of the Pandharkawda Village total population. Out of these, around 155 (155) are male workers, and about 97 (97) are female workers.
